Trailer For Tightrope Movie Is Making People Vomit

A trailer for a film about Philippe Petit’s famous balancing act between the Twin Towers The Walk is causing film-goers to vomit from vertigo.

This isn’t the first time Petit’s 1974 walk has been turned into a film, back in 2008 the Oscar-winning documentary, Man on Wire, used first-hand accounts and footage of the event.

The Walk director Robert Zemeckis has taken a different route, the film starring Joseph Gordon-Levitt uses 3D wizardry to take the viewer onto the wire with Petit as he walks between the two towers. The Twin Towers were 450 meters high.

The director Zemeckis said in a press conference at the New York Film Festival that vomit is the intention.

The Walk hits cinemas 22nd October.
